gpt4 book ai didi

ios - 在UIAccessibilityContainer中,使用 `accessibilityElements`和其他三种方法有什么区别?

转载 作者:塔克拉玛干 更新时间:2023-11-02 10:20:08 25 4
gpt4 key购买 nike

在 iOS 8 中,Apple 引入了 var accessibilityElements: [Any]?

  • func accessibilityElementCount() -> Int
  • func accessibilityElement(at: Int) -> Any?
  • func index(ofAccessibilityElement: Any) -> Int

它们有什么区别? var accessibilityElements: [Any]? 的优先级是否高于旧方法?

引用:https://developer.apple.com/documentation/uikit/accessibility/uiaccessibilitycontainer

最佳答案

我没有具体的证据给你,但我的建议是你使用新的证据:var accessibilityElements: [Any]? 如果你的目标是 iOS 8 及更高版本。

为什么?因为我相信旧方法将来会被弃用。他们是多余的。通过数组访问它还允许您执行其他方法,因为它们是内置在数组中的。

Tl:dr API 没有说明它们之间有任何区别,所以请使用较新的 API。

关于ios - 在UIAccessibilityContainer中,使用 `accessibilityElements`和其他三种方法有什么区别?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/56036203/

25 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com